Our Volunteers Rock!

The Monday before a conference is a full day for conference organizers and volunteers. By 9:00 a.m. this morning, volunteers were already hard at work stuffing the conference bags and attending the volunteer training. The bags were all stuffed by 10:45 a.m., which may have broken the record. All of these folks will be returning this week to work at registration, the hospitality table, as room monitors, and Ask Me volunteers.

A big thank you to all the volunteers. We couldn’t do it without your help!

Get involved with the conference-volunteer!

 Volunteers Needed!

 Once you get a chance to look at the syllabus and pick your sessions, you might see that you'll have some spare time during the conference. Please consider volunteering!

It takes many, many people to keep everything running smoothly during such a large conference, and volunteering is a fun way to get to know other genealogists.

Shifts are available at various times from Monday–Saturday. Registration workers, Ask Me hosts , room monitors, and Youth Camp registration (Saturday, 7:45 a.m.–8:45 a.m.) are all needed.

Registration volunteer
Check in pre-registered attendees, verify, and distribute registration materials.

Ask Me host volunteers
Stationed at key points around the conference area to answer attendee questions about room locations, directions to lecture rooms and restrooms, lecture times, and other general queries.

Room monitors
Assist with readying lecture room, monitor admissions, help speaker or attendees if necessary, and obtain room count.
